    All the gladiators should be pissed off, especially Spartacus. After he spends all that time helping Batiatus and teaching the 15 yr old kid about the honor code of the gladiator, the kid just spits in his face by forcing Spartacus to dishonorably kill Varro. Clearly it was from Ilithyia's manipulation, but it was clear that the kid understood that the gladiators were about a code of honor above just pain and bloodshed (i.e. the "brother" vs. Crixus lesson that honor and pride are vital and can be preserved in defeat). Still, the kid just goes along with Ilithyia's plan to get his dick wet. Fuck him.

    This should signal the complete breakdown of Spartacus's and Batiatus's relationship. Spartacus will be furious for Batiatus showing no spine towards Varro's death. He'll also clearly know that even though Batiatus has been friendly and generous to Spartacus, he's still a pawn that is cast aside when Batiatus wishes. It's a clear message that he's nothing more than a slave, and may get him focused on breaking out.

    Batiatus will be humiliated that he was rejected by the magistrate, and his insecurity will cause him to lash out. Lucretia's scolding that he spends too much time with Spartacus will hit home, and he'll be sure to compensate by demonstrating that he is "dominus".

    Ashur will be key in the whole thing completely going to shit. He's clearly clever and has no loyalties to anyone but himself. I wonder if the fact that Naevia saw Barca's murder will force Ashur to move against her. Like a previous poster said, I'd bet Ashur tell's Lucretia, and as a result Naevia is either sold or killed. This sends Crixus into a rage, and willing to take down the ludus.

    I can't remember exactly if Ashur knows Batiatus murdered Spartacus's wife, but if he does, I wouldn't be surprised it comes to light. Ashur has been playing too many sides, and he's going to get cornered. When he does, huge revelations will come to light.

    I still have no idea how Doctore will fit in to the whole storyline. For a while it seemed like he would expose Ashur as a fraud, but he's been silent about it for a long time now. It doesn't seem like he'd join the gladiator slave rebellion, but it also doesn't seem like he'd stand up for all the blatant wrongdoings that have been going on. Should be interesting to see what happens.
